Anatomic and Clinical Pathology Residency Program

Program Director: Alexandra Brown, MD

Number of residents (per year / total): 2-3/12

Average work hours on surg path? 50 hrs/week

Are you allowed to do external rotations? Yes – Faculty are very supportive of residents in pursuing their goals and interests.

  • Wide range of specimens and pathology (only academic medical center in the state)
  • Energetic faculty who like to teach
  • Relatively laid back atmosphere
  • Good board pass rates
  • In general, residents get good and competitive fellowships
  • Approachable, friendly attendings, good resident-to-attending ratio
  • Excellent new Chair, Janice Lage
  • Attendings give ample slide preview time
  • Research opportunities available, but not mandatory

Do you feel you have: Adequate preview time?

  • Yes – encouraged to write up cases on our own

Adequate support staff (P.A.’s, secretarial, etc.)?

  • Yes – We have a young energetic Masters degree level Pathologists' Assistant who actively grosses specimens and teaches residents
  • Three MLT's gross most biopsies
  • Grossing days are rarely >10 hours.
